Disregard False Reports On Alleged Meeting Blaming EC's IT Department - EC

The Electoral Commission has noted with concern a news story published by The Herald Ghana on 14th December, 2020 and subsequently circulated on social media alleging a meeting where blame was cast on the EC’s IT Department regarding the collation of the 2020 Election results.

The Commission wishes to categorically state that this is FALSE. No such meeting was held on the 14th December, 2020 as alleged, neither will any such meeting be held.

The Election results as declared remain unchanged. They are based on evidence and facts from the Pink Sheets approved and signed by Agents of the Political Parties.

For the information of the General Public, the collation of the 2020 Election results was done manually at the Polling Stations, Constituency and Regional Collation Centres before they were forwarded through fax/email to the National Collation Centre at the Head Office of the Commission.

No software was used for the collation of results as purported in the false news story.
